Connect started its first phase with its licensed Wireless Broadband network in the city of Juba and expanded its wireless network it to BOR and WAU in phase 2, enabling its customers to have access to high-speed wireless internet connectivity at highly competitive prices. We are working on expanding our wireless service network in phase 3 to cover major cities through South Sudan.

Connect’s cores networks are dimensioned and optimized to ensure high service reliability, secured environment for multi-branching solutions, easy scalability and low latency.

Our network features include


Internet backbone by using a terrestrial transmission link to access the global internet exchange


Redundant structure utilizing two distinct independent routes as well as two different service providers, and backed up by satellite connectivity to Europe Tier One’s teleport, for terrestrial connectivity.


High reliability and availability achieved by using the latest wireless access solution technology along with redundant critical core components, insuring the availability of redundant power supply for the major network components.


Scalability through a flexible network architecture based on top performing Cisco core and edge devices which enables fast and smooth future growth and expansion.


Accessibility of different major cities using partner backbone capabilities.
